]> git.lizzy.rs Git - plan9front.git/commitdiff
secstore: read server from $secstore environment variable
authormischief <mischief@offblast.org>
Mon, 11 Aug 2014 01:05:57 +0000 (18:05 -0700)
committermischief <mischief@offblast.org>
Mon, 11 Aug 2014 01:05:57 +0000 (18:05 -0700)
this allows setting the secstore server with secstore=tcp!example.com!secstore or secstore='$secstore' to read from ndb.

sys/src/cmd/auth/secstore/secstore.c

index bfcacaa1e50b656e9a6362e4b44ebcd07d3f8226..13e86f4ada67a1bdb1528fb7cd2c0fcf3ace7bef 100644 (file)
@@ -495,7 +495,9 @@ main(int argc, char **argv)
        char *gfile[MAXFILES+1], *pfile[MAXFILES+1], *rfile[MAXFILES+1];
        AuthConn *c;
 
-       serve = "$auth";
+       serve = getenv("secstore");
+       if(serve == nil)
+               serve = "$auth";
        user = getuser();
        memset(Gflag, 0, sizeof Gflag);